BOLOGNA. Inter defeats Bologna 1-0 after Y. Bisseck scored just 1 goal (37′). Bologna lost this match even if it was superior in terms of ball possession (60%).

The match was played at the Stadio Renato Dall’Ara stadium in Bologna on Saturday and it started at 6:00 pm local time. The referee was Luca Pairetto who had the assistance of Ciro Carbone and Alessandro Giallatini. The 4th official was Antonio Rapuano. The weather was moderate rain. The temperature was cold at 10.59 degrees Celsius or 51.06 Fahrenheit. The humidity was 81%.​

Ball possession

Bologna had a superior ball possession 60% while Inter was struggling with a 40% ball possession.

Attitude and shots

Bologna was more aggressive with 54 dangerous attacks and 19 shots of which 3 were on target. Anyhow, Inter was capable to find the solution to win this match.​

Bologna shot 19 times, 3 on target, 6 off target. Regarding the opposition, Inter shot 5 times, 4 on target, 2 off target.

Cards

Bologna received 2 yellow cards (Remo Freuler and Joshua Zirkzee). On the opposite side, Inter received 1 yellow card (Davy Klaassen).

Bologna started with a mid-fielder-oriented line-up (4-1-4-1).

The manager Thiago Motta decided to play with the following team: Lukasz Skorupski (7.1), Stefan Posch (7.0), Sam Beukema (6.7), Jhon Lucumí (7.3), Victor Kristiansen (7.5), Remo Freuler (7.0), Jens Odgaard (7.0), Michel Aebischer (6.7), Lewis Ferguson (7.5), Alexis Saelemaekers (7.1) and Joshua Zirkzee (6.7).

The home team had on the bench: Dan Ndoye (7.3), Mihajlo Ilic, Nikola Moro (6.8), Tommaso Corazza, Oussama El Azzouzi, Santiago Castro (6.7), Charalampos Lykogiannis, Nicola Bagnolini, Lorenzo De Silvestri, Federico Ravaglia, Kacper Urbanski, Riccardo Calafiori, Riccardo Orsolini  (7.1) and Giovanni Fabbian.

Substitutions

Bologna made 4 changes: Alexis Saelemaekers for Dan Ndoye (74′), Michel Aebischer for Nikola Moro (69′), Jens Odgaard for Riccardo Orsolini  (79′) and Joshua Zirkzee for Santiago Castro (79′).

Player of the match: Victor Kristiansen​

The most impressive player for Bologna was Victor Kristiansen.

His rating is 7.5 with 78 passes (94% accurate) and 0 key passes. He won 1 duel out of 2. He performed 1 cross.

Inter started with a 3-5-2 line-up (3-5-2).

Simone Inzaghi played with: Yann Sommer (7.5), Yann Bisseck (8.1), Francesco Acerbi (7.7), Alessandro Bastoni (8.2), Matteo Darmian (7.0), Nicolò Barella (6.6), Hakan Çalhanoğlu  (7.1), Henrikh Mkhitaryan (7.1), Carlos Augusto (7.3), Marcus Thuram (7.3) and Alexis Sánchez (7.0).

The following players were sitting on the bench: Stefan de Vrij, Kristjan Asllani (6.7), Marko Arnautović (6.6), Raffaele Di Gennaro, Davy Klaassen (6.7), Davide Frattesi (6.7), Tajon Buchanan, Emil Audero, Benjamin Pavard, Denzel Dumfries (6.6), Federico Dimarco and Lautaro Martínez.

Inter could not rely on the presence of Marko Arnautović (injured).

Substitutions

Inter made 5 changes: Nicolò Barella for Davy Klaassen (80′), Marcus Thuram for Marko Arnautović (66′), Carlos Augusto for Denzel Dumfries (46′), Henrikh Mkhitaryan for Davide Frattesi (61′) and Hakan Çalhanoğlu  for Kristjan Asllani (61′).

Player of the match: Alessandro Bastoni​

The player that probably impressed the most for Inter was Alessandro Bastoni even if he didn’t score the decisive goal.

His rating is 8.2 with 73 passes (89% accurate) and 1 key pass. He won 7 duels out of 8. He performed 2 crosses.
